Bayaan, the musical ensemble that achieved national recognition by triumphing in the 2018 edition of Pepsi Battle of the Bands, outshining contenders like Xarb, continues to produce captivating music that resonates with every release.
Comprising of members Asfar Hussain (lead vocalist), Haider Abbas (bassist), Shahrukh Aslam (guitarist), Muqeet Shahzad (guitarist), and Mansoor Lashari (drummer), they unveiled their album “Suno” in 2020 following their victory in the Pepsi competition. While not necessarily groundbreaking, it certainly stood as a commendable album.
Amid the pandemic-induced lull in live music, Bayaan adeptly harnessed technology, introducing the Bayaan Quarantine Sessions. They even generously shared guitar tutorials for some of their cherished tracks.
Zooming into 2022, Asfar Hussain collaborated with Arooj Aftab in the 14th installment of Coke Studio, contributing to the song “Mehram.” This collaboration significantly elevated both Asfar Hussain’s individual prominence and the band’s collective fame.
Alongside the album’s release in 2020, Bayaan capitalized on the enthusiasm of both fans and critics, releasing captivating music videos periodically, including hits like “Teri Tasveer” and “Faryaad.” In November 2022, Bayaan unveiled the single and accompanying music video “Tayraak,” an innovative and animated creation brimming with raw emotion.
The Essence of Bayaan’s Emotion
Stepping into the New Year, Bayaan has embraced a more optimistic approach by gifting their fans a fresh track titled “Dil Ka Ghar” (The Home of the Heart), a stark contrast to the vibe of “Tayraak.” Crafted under the production of Rakae Jamil at Red Brick Music Studios, with lyrics penned by lead vocalist Asfar Hussain, and masterfully directed by Muaaz Ullah Tarar, the music video showcases the scenic beauty of Azad Jammu & Kashmir as a picturesque backdrop that harmoniously complements the song.
As Asfar’s vocals serenade the notion of establishing roots in this enchanting locale, evoking imagery of snow-capped peaks and candid band moments amidst rugged terrains, it becomes a poignant homage to a region that has endured its share of turbulence and strife.
The stunning landscape depicted in the video might just inspire one to trade urban hustle for the tranquility of Kashmir, echoing Bayaan’s sentiment of embracing it as a cherished abode.
Embedded subtly within the lyrics are references to the sounds and scents of the region, cleverly entwined with tender vocals and harmonious melodies.
In essence, this composition leans heavily on acoustic tonalities, shaping a musical narrative that keeps listeners intrigued, hinting at Bayaan’s evolving artistic direction. For now, dive into the enchanting world of “Dil Ka Ghar,” a soulful creation that encapsulates Bayaan’s musical journey.
